Background
The pedal of traditional hydraulic ram is as shown in fig. 1, it includes footboard 1, footboard 1 one end is rotated through pivot 2 and is connected in 3 lateral walls of hydraulic ram, footboard 1 below is equipped with the driving plate 4 of liftable, driving plate 4 has one side to stretch into in the hydraulic ram 3 with piston spare rigid coupling, and be connected with spring 6 between driving plate 4 and the hydraulic ram base 5, can make driving plate 4 descend when the pedal is stepped on to the foot, thereby make the piston spare synchronous decline of hydraulic ram 3, footboard 1 when loosening footboard 1, driving plate 4 resets under the effect of spring 6. According to the pedal structure of the hydraulic jack, the pedal 1 is always arranged on the transmission plate 4 and supported by the transmission plate 4, so that the spring 6 is slightly compressed through the transmission plate 4 even if the pedal 1 does not work, and the problem that a small amount of oil liquid still enters the hydraulic jack when the pedal 1 does not work is caused.

Detailed Description
The present invention will be further explained with reference to the drawings and examples.
As shown in fig. 2 and 3, the pedal improved structure of the hydraulic jack comprises a pedal 1 and a transmission plate 4, wherein one end of the pedal 1 is rotatably connected to the side wall of the hydraulic jack 3, the transmission plate 4 is positioned below the pedal 1, a spring 6 is connected between the bottom of the transmission plate 4 and a base 5 of the hydraulic jack, one side of the transmission plate 4 extends into the hydraulic jack 3 and is fixedly connected with a piston piece, and the pedal 1 is suspended above the transmission plate 4 through an elastic suspension connecting piece. The 3 lateral walls fixedly connected with of hydraulic ram hangs in the outstanding roof beam 7 of footboard 1 top, the elasticity hangs in midair the connecting piece including supporting in the supporting baseplate 8 of footboard 1 bottom, supporting baseplate 8 is connected with vertical board 9, outstanding roof beam 7 slidable mounting has vertical connecting rod 10, vertical connecting rod 10 lower extreme passes outstanding roof beam 7 and the vertical board of fixed connection 9, vertical connecting rod 10 upper end is located outstanding roof beam 7 top, vertical connecting rod 10 upper end is connected with roof plate 11, be connected with between roof plate 11 and the outstanding roof beam 7 and overlap supporting spring 12 outside vertical connecting rod 10.
The utility model discloses in, one section of 8 top surfaces of supporting baseplate is the plane that the inclined plane, another section flush with the inclined plane peak, and the plane has ball 13 through ball groove roll mounting, is supported in footboard 1 bottom by ball 13.
The utility model discloses in, 7 top fixedly connected with vertical guide arms 14 of hanging oneself from roof beam, vertical guide arm 14 passes and cooperates with roof 11 relative sliding from roof 11.
